Caffeine

Caffeine is used in skincare for its antioxidant properties and ability to reduce puffiness. It can improve the appearance of the skin by constricting blood vessels. It is generally well-tolerated in topical applications.

Risks

In rare cases, caffeine can cause skin irritation or allergic reactions.

Benefits

Caffeine can help reduce under-eye puffiness and dark circles, making the skin appear more refreshed.

Epigallocatechin Gallatyl Glucoside

Epigallocatechin Gallatyl Glucoside is a derivative of green tea extract known for its antioxidant properties. It helps protect the skin from environmental damage. It is considered safe and beneficial for most skin types.

Risks

There are minimal risks associated with this ingredient, though sensitive skin may experience mild irritation.

Benefits

This ingredient provides strong antioxidant benefits, helping to reduce signs of aging and improve skin health.

Hyaluronic Acid

Hyaluronic Acid is a powerful humectant that attracts and retains moisture in the skin. It is widely used in skincare for its hydrating properties. It is non-irritating and suitable for all skin types.

Risks

There are no significant risks associated with hyaluronic acid in topical applications.

Benefits

Hyaluronic Acid helps to plump the skin, reduce the appearance of fine lines, and improve skin texture.
